Prasad Ram, Director of Engineering (Google Research) and former Head of Google's R&D Center in India has left the company earlier this month, a Google India spokesperson has confirmed to MediaNama. Peeyush Ranjan is currently MD for Google India R&D. Ram has started an education focused non-profit startup called Ednovo, which is going to build upon Gooru, a free web based education solution that was begun as a '20% effort' at Google, and piloted in India with 25 classrooms and 1000 students. Gooru allows teachers to use openly licensed web resources, find lesson plans on all subjects and topics and then customize it to their specific needs, with rich multimedia content including videos, slides, and simulations. Remember that Rajan Anandan, former Microsoft India MD was brought in to head Google India earlier this month, so that Shailesh Rao could focus entirely on the companys display business as MD (Japan and Asia-Pacific) for Media and Platform Sales.
